someone@selfhosted.xyz writes: > Hi, > > I have several times over tried to install to a LUKS-partition with > btrfs and failed but last time I almost had success. guix init command > complained that the bios_grub flag wasn't set after many hours of > compiling packages and therefore didn't install grub at first. I > checked the partition with "cryptsetup luksUUID /dev/sda1" before > rerunning guix init and it gives me the luksUUID so the partition > seemed intact up to that point. However, after setting the bios_grub > flag and rerunning guix init, the installation is successful but > afterwards the cryptsetup luksUUID command says that the partition is > not a valid luks device, so it seems like the GRUB installation part > is what ruins the partition. What is your partition layout? The "bios_grub" partition must be a separate (typically tiny) partition with no other data on it.
